14 connections·17 entities in this video→Original Sin: Biden's Re-election Decision
- 💡 The "original sin" discussed in a new book is not a cover-up, but Biden's decision to run for re-election despite apparent cognitive decline.
- 🎯 This choice is attributed to stubborn pride and a desire for people in power to stay in power, overriding self-evident issues.
Evidence of Cognitive Decline
- 🧠 By 2023-2024, Biden exhibited a stiffer gait, difficulty speaking publicly, and trouble maintaining a train of thought.
- 📸 His public appearances were heavily scripted and managed by aides, with note cards often revealed by photographers.
- 📉 His decline significantly hastened in the last year and a half of his first term, appearing different even from his re-election announcement.
Bombshell Revelations from the Book
- 🤯 A key revelation is that Biden didn't recognize George Clooney at a fundraiser, requiring former President Obama to intervene.
- ⚠️ Details emerged about a potential fall that could have led to Biden being placed in a wheelchair, a fact the White House allegedly refused to make public.
- 📌 The cumulative effect of these incidents is described as a "death of a thousand paper cuts," suggesting close associates prioritized keeping Biden in power to maintain their own positions.
Media Access and Journalist Challenges
- 🗣️ In contrast to Trump's frequent media availability, the White House reportedly stonewalled journalists seeking access to Biden.
- 📰 This lack of access hindered reporters from uncovering the full story regarding Biden's condition.
Legacy and Future Considerations
- 💔 The framing of the New Yorker piece suggests Biden's hubris and desire to stay in power may have handed Trump the next election.
- 🏖️ It's suggested Biden should retire to enjoy his later years, being celebrated for his civil service rather than judged on his current state.
- 🤔 The author notes that at an advanced age, one might not be as sharp, implying a need for empathy.
